After some quick research. I added the area and/or habitat I took a look at between brackets.
  • White-naped crane: Swan goose [Northeastern China wetlands]
  • Black-necked crane: Bar-headed goose, Tufted duck, Common merganser [Wetlands of the Tibetan Plateau]
  • Hooded crane: Mandarin duck, Baikal teal, Eastern spot-billed duck, Eurasian wigeon, Northern pintail [Wintering grounds in Izumi, Kagoshima Prefecture, Kyushu, Japan]
  • Common crane: Garganey, Eurasian teal, Eurasian curlew [Eurasian boglands]
